Появляется подключение для воспроизведения игр, но ничего не происходит

#c# #unity3d #google-play-games

#c# #unity3d #google-play-games

Вопрос:

Я добавил кнопку входа в Google, и я правильно реализовал все ключи входа и сертификаты, поэтому, когда я нажимаю на кнопку входа в систему, появляется надпись «Подключение к играм», затем появляется зеленый круг на 1 секунду, и после этого ничего не происходит, я вызываю вход с кнопки, и аутентификация завершена.сделано при запуске. Пожалуйста, помогите

Примечание: я создаю эту игру в Unity и использую последнюю версию плагина play games (0.10.11)

 public class PlayGamesController : MonoBehaviour {

private void Start()
{
    AuthenticateUser();
}

public void AuthenticateUser()
{
PlayGamesClientConfiguration config = new PlayGamesClientConfiguration.Builder().Build();
    PlayGamesPlatform.InitializeInstance(config);
    PlayGamesPlatform.Activate();
}
public void SignIn()
{
   
    Social.localUser.Authenticate((bool success) =>
    {
        if (success == true)
        {
            Debug.Log("Logged in to Google Play Games Services");

        }
        else
        {
            Debug.LogError("Unable to log in to Google Play Games Services");
        }
    });
}

}
 

Комментарии:

1. Кроме того, я создал 2 связанных учетных данных как для ключей входа, так и для ключей, соответствующих моим ключам хранилища ключей и play console, так что даже там проблем нет, я искал буквально везде и, похоже, не могу с этим справиться, любая помощь приветствуется. Спасибо

Ответ №1:

РЕШАЕМАЯ: Проблема заключалась в том, что на моем телефоне была добавлена еще одна учетная запись Google вместе с тестовой учетной записью, и мне просто пришлось удалить другую, и бум, она успешно вошла в систему. Поэтому для всех, у кого это есть или может быть когда-либо, следите за учетными записями, которые у вас есть, кроме тестовой учетной записи.